Core Viewpoint - The article discusses the recent financing and technological advancements of the autonomous truck company, Mainline Technology, emphasizing its focus on L4-level autonomous driving solutions and the development of a comprehensive logistics ecosystem [5][6]. Financing and Business Development - Mainline Technology recently completed a financing round of several hundred million yuan, aimed at scaling its core products and expanding into more autonomous logistics scenarios [5]. - The company has delivered nearly 1,000 smart trucks, achieving close to 100 million kilometers in intelligent transport mileage [6]. Technological Innovations - Mainline Technology is developing an L4-level autonomous driving system called AiTrucker, which integrates multi-sensor fusion and a high-performance central computing platform [7]. - The company is also advancing its Trunk CAFC solution, which enables mixed convoy driving through deep integration of autonomous driving, vehicle-to-vehicle communication, and cloud collaboration, resulting in a 20% reduction in operational costs, an 18% improvement in energy efficiency, and a 22% reduction in carbon emissions [7][8]. Operational Achievements - Mainline Technology has established partnerships with major logistics companies and ports, including Tianjin Port and Ningbo-Zhoushan Port, and has developed a Trunk Port solution for smart port operations, serving over 800,000 TEUs [9][10]. - The company is actively involved in road freight scenarios, collaborating with leading logistics firms to cover key regions in China, with over 95% of its driving mileage being autonomous [12]. Future Plans - Mainline Technology plans to expand into urban logistics by launching related products in key cities by the end of the year, aiming for a revenue distribution of 3:5:2 across port logistics, road freight, and urban delivery [13]. - The company is also focusing on international markets, having delivered nearly 100 autonomous trucks in Southeast Asia, the Middle East, and South America, with expectations for rapid growth in these regions [13].

18项举措推动食品工业数字化转型
Xiao Fei Ri Bao Wang· 2025-06-16 02:42
Core Viewpoint - The Ministry of Industry and Information Technology, along with other departments, has issued the "Implementation Plan for the Digital Transformation of the Food Industry," aiming to accelerate the integration of digital technologies into the food industry. Group 1: Digital Transformation Goals - By 2027, the digital management penetration rate of key food enterprises is expected to reach 80%, with the CNC rate of key processes and the penetration rate of digital R&D design tools in large-scale food enterprises both reaching 75% [1] - The plan aims to cultivate over 10 intelligent factories, establish more than 5 high-standard digital parks, create hundreds of typical digital transformation application scenarios, and develop a batch of high-level digital transformation service providers in the food industry [1] - By 2030, the comprehensive application of new-generation information technology in large-scale food enterprises is anticipated, fostering a group of internationally competitive digital industrial clusters in the food sector [1] Group 2: Specific Measures - The plan outlines four action areas: innovation in information technology applications, cultivation of new models and new business formats, quality enhancement and upgrading of the industry, and foundational empowerment [1] - It includes 18 specific measures, such as promoting the application of new technology, enhancing the supply of AI model technology products in niche food sectors, and developing flexible manufacturing for small-batch and diverse products [1] - The plan emphasizes the intelligent upgrade of enterprises, accelerating the renovation of key process equipment and software in R&D, production, and testing [1] Group 3: Current Status - Currently, the CNC rate of key processes and the penetration rate of digital R&D design tools in China's food industry are 63.3% and 72.8%, respectively [2] - Leading enterprises in sectors such as dairy and beverage manufacturing have achieved world-leading levels in intelligent factory development [2]
